Tron energy is a key resource within the TRON ecosystem, enabling users to execute transactions and perform other operations on the blockchain. Unlike traditional transaction fees in other blockchain networks, Tron energy is used to pay for computational resources and the power required to process transactions and run smart contracts.
In order to access Tron energy, users must freeze **TRX tokens**. The amount of energy that a user receives is directly related to the amount of TRX tokens they freeze. For example, the more TRX you freeze, the more energy you receive. However, freezing TRX has its drawbacks, such as the fact that it locks up your tokens for a period of time, reducing liquidity and limiting your ability to use your TRX for other purposes.

There are several ways to obtain **affordable Tron energy**. Below are some strategies you can use to reduce costs and optimize your energy usage on the TRON network:
Freezing TRX to obtain energy is the most direct method, but freezing too much TRX can lead to unnecessary costs and liquidity issues. To optimize energy usage, it is important to freeze only the amount of TRX that you need for your transaction and contract requirements.
For example, if you are an individual user with a low volume of transactions, freezing a small amount of TRX will suffice. On the other hand, developers and businesses that require frequent interactions with the blockchain may need to freeze a larger amount of TRX to ensure they have enough energy for their operations. The key is to balance your freezing strategy to avoid locking up more TRX than you need.
One of the most effective ways to access affordable Tron energy is by using the **energy rental** system. Tron energy rental allows users to rent energy from other users who have frozen TRX. This system offers significant advantages, especially for users who do not want to lock up their TRX or who only need energy for short-term transactions.
Renting energy allows you to pay for exactly the amount of energy you need, without freezing large amounts of TRX. Energy rental is a cost-effective solution for developers and users who have fluctuating energy needs or who need energy for specific transactions or short-term operations.
